This topic summarizes the technical changes for OMEGAMON AI Insights v 2.2.0.

November 2025

OMEGAMON AI Insights introduces predictive AI capabilities to help your monitoring team identify performance issues early, such as CPU spikes or slow response times, without requiring data science expertise. This release adds new features and enhancements to strengthen the models and improve integration with your existing ecosystem.

Support extended to IBM Z OMEGAMON AI for Db2
For OMEGAMON AI for Db2 6.1, OMEGAMON AI Insights now provides actionable data, analysis, and alerts. These enhancements enable real-time monitoring and help proactively detect anomalies in CPU time.
Alerting capabilities extended down to 15 minutes for specific contexts
You can now configure alerts to trigger at 15-minute intervals for selected monitoring contexts.
Optimized alerting for anomalous behavior
The alerting logic has been improved to reduce duplicate alerts for the same issue when anomalies are detected.
New feedback loop for forecasting anomalies
A feedback mechanism is available to help manage and refine anomaly forecasts.
Kibana replaced by Grafana dashboards.
Grafana now provides the out-of-the-box dashboards for visualization and monitoring.
Extended alert customization with native Grafana Alerting
You can use native alerting features of Grafana to customize alerts for your environment.
Integration into ecosystem with generic webhooks
Alerts can now be integrated into your automation workflows using generic webhooks for better visibility and action.
Extended support for x86-64 Linux environments
OMEGAMON AI Insights now supports deployment on x86-64 Linux systems.
Container distribution with expanded platform support
OMEGAMON AI Insights is distributed as a container and now supports x86-64 Linux, IBM Linux on Z and IBM Z Container Extensions.
